Subject: Handover — validator plugin stuff

Hey Priya,

Passing you the baton on Checkwright, our plugin system for data validators. The new schema-drift plugin shipped Tuesday and mostly behaves, but it occasionally flags empty CSV uploads as "malformed" — harmless, just noisy. I've muted the alert until Friday. If support escalates anything about plugin load failures, the fix is usually bumping the registry cache. Questions after I'm off? Reach the Checkwright maintainers at the address below.

billing contact of hawip-kahif = zorwyn@tolvaqlabs.corp

Role-based access in the Lanternwiki is managed through three tiers: Reader, Curator, and Steward. New hires start as Readers and are promoted to Curator after their first sprint, which unlocks page edits and template creation. Stewards alone may modify access policies, and any tier change must be recorded in the access log before the weekly eng sync. Automation that syncs group membership authenticates against the internal directory service using the key below:

service key, fawip-bajef: kto11_Qt5wZK9vdNC

## Tuning offline mode
Fieldmark's offline mode queues survey submissions on-device and syncs when connectivity returns. Sync aggressiveness trades battery against data freshness: shorter intervals drain rural crews' devices, longer ones risk losing a day's work if a tablet dies. We also cap the local queue so storage doesn't fill on long expeditions. Defaults suit most deployments. Override them only via the constants defined below.

tuning table, yajog-yahof:
BUDGETS = {
    "lamvan": 303,
    "wenox": 460,
    "fenvan": 525,
}

## Step 4 — Publish Gridsmith

Build the crossword generator bundle with `make dist`. Run the puzzle validity suite; all 300 fixtures must pass. Tag the release, then upload to the Lettervault registry. Do not skip checksum verification. Sign the tarball before upload using the deploy key that follows.

deploy key for kajof-fajop: bky6_gDHw9Q